Transaction 3868927e5a0b3277424c3fe46c917ea302b810c605c2e15fb52c2114936cf433
1 Input
1 Output
-
3868927e5a0b3277424c3fe46c917ea302b810c605c2e15fb52c2114936cf433:0
- value
- 345161
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ab9516176a97eac7a7f0947a50318297e229d55a
- address
- bc1q4w23v9m2jl4v0flsj3a9qvvzjl3zn4264h3jzv